Mission and Program Overview

Mission

The mission of every third saturday is to foster hope and support post traumatic growth for veterans and their families.

The mission of every third saturday (ets) is to foster hope and promote post traumatic growth for veterans. Our mission is accomplished via 4 main methods. First, we offer veterans an opportunity to shop free of charge for clothing and supplies in our supply store. Second, ets offers a 5 week course for veterans that focuses on personal development and acheivinng post traumatic growth in response to trauma. Third, the organization offers emergency assistance grants to veteran in financial need. Finally, ets offers veteran internships to support veterans who are moving towards re-enetering the workforce but can benefit from a structured and sheltered work environment to assist them in their path forward.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 2

Tom mckenna and jessi mckenna - family relationship scott marrier and darrell marrier - family relationship

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

The form 990 is prepared by an independent accountant for internal review. Upon completion, it is reviewed by the board chair and treasurer before it is filed with the irs.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

Any director, officer, employee and any member who serve on any ets committee with governing board delegated powers must disclose the existence of any financial interest that may create any actual or possible conflict of interest in any transaction or arrangement. A person has a financial interest if the person has, directly or indirectly, through business, investment, or family: an ownership or investment interest in any entity with which ets has a transaction or arrangement; or a compensation arrangement with ets or with any entity or individual with which ets has a transaction or arrangement; or a potential ownership or investment interest in, or compensation arrangement with, any entity or individual with which ets is negotiating a transaction or arrangement. The following procedures are in place to address any conflict of interest: - an interested person may make a presentation at the board or executive committee meeting, but after the presentation, he/she shall leave the meeting during the discussion of, and the vote on, the transaction, arrangement, or other matter involving the possible conflict of interest. - the chairperson of the board or executive committee shall, if appropriate, appoint a disinterested person or committee to investigate alternatives to the proposed transaction or arrangement. - after exercising due diligence, the board or executive committee shall determine whether ets can obtain with reasonable efforts a more advantageous transaction or arrangement from a person or entity that would not give rise to a financial conflict of interest. - if a more advantageous transaction or arrangement is not reasonably possible under circumstances not producing a financial conflict of interest, the board or executive committee shall determine by a majority vote of the disinterested directors whether the transaction or arrangement is in ets's best interest, for its own benefit, and whether it is fair and reasonable. In conformity with the above determination, it shall make its decision as to whether to enter into the transaction or arrangement.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15A

The process for determining compensation for the executive director was arrived at via board vote. After reviewing comparable compensation levels for similar job titles and responsibilities and a thorough review of the ceo compensation survey conducted by the minnesota council on non profits, compensation for both paid employees was approved by unanimous vote.

Form 990, Part VI, Section C, Line 19

The organization's governing documents, conflict of interest policy, and financial statements are available to the public upon request.
